it was shot with a pentax optio W60, then strung together in quicktime and edited in imovie. the optio is a small point and shoot that has good resolution and a timelapse feature that shoots (at it's fastest) one frame every 10 seconds. one downfall is that it will only shoot 1000 frames before shutting off. overall, though, it works really well. if we need to shoot more than 1000 frames we use a canon 30D or 5D.
